These devices employed by the painter are drawn from external influences and experiences, namely the Turin-based Group of Six. This artistic collective, formed in 1928 under the influence of Edoardo Persico, included artists such as Enrico Paulucci, Nicola Galante, Gigi Chessa, Francesco Menzio, Carlo Levi, and Jessie Boswell. It was distinguished by its distinctive characteristics: its rebellion against Futurism, although there was a connection on a pictorial-intellectual level; its international influence, particularly in the Parisian context, with attention to Modigliani, Manet, and Dufy; and its interest in social representation.\u003c\/span\u003e \u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p class=\"Corpo\" style=\"text-align: justify;\"\u003e\u003cspan style=\"font-family: 'Avenir Next LT Pro',sans-serif;\"\u003eThe work we observe expresses a delicate line and a simplified composition. The luminous element emerges with calm and purity.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n \u003cp class=\"Corpo\" style=\"text-align: justify;\"\u003e\u003cspan style=\"font-family: 'Avenir Next LT Pro',sans-serif;\"\u003eLeonardo Stroppa (1900 – 1991) was a figurative painter from Turin who frequented the avant-garde circles of the Accademia Albertina and the Gruppo dei 6 in Turin. A painter with a distinctly European taste, he interacted with the leading exponents of Parisian painting of the time. One of his works is exhibited at the Galleria d'Arte Moderna in Turin, and many others were shown in Antwerp, Paris, and Zurich. In his artistic production, the painter's preferred medium was watercolor.\u003c\/span\u003e \u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p class=\"Corpo\" style=\"text-align: justify;\"\u003e\u003cspan style=\"font-family: 'Avenir Next LT Pro',sans-serif;\"\u003e \u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Stefania Giorsa","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":56219067580802,"sku":"SGIO006","price":450.0,"currency_code":"EUR","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0909\/7065\/3058\/files\/Stroppa-acquarello-vaso-con-rose-gialle-25x33-1-e1703236663139.jpg?v=1768477880","url":"https:\/\/cjfh11-ee.myshopify.com\/en\/products\/stroppa-leonardo-vaso-con-rose-gialle","provider":"Venderequadri","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
